Goa rape case: Minister's son surrenders

The son of Goa's Education Minister Babush Monserrat, Rohit Monserrat, who is accused of raping a minor German girl, has surrendered at the Calangute police station in Goa. A complaint was filed last month by the girl's mother, Fadela Fuchs. According to sources, the victim in her statement to a magistrate on Saturday said she had consensual sex with the minister's son, a charge which has denied by the accused in his statement to the police.
